HTAP系统中的列式存储与行式存储动态切换机制.docxVIP

HTAP系统中的列式存储与行式存储动态切换机制.doc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

HTAP系统中的列式存储与行式存储动态切换机制

摘要

本报告系统性地研究了混合事务/分析处理(HTAP)系统中列式存储与行式存储的动态切换机制。随着大数据时代的到来,企业对实时分析能力的需求日益增长,传统OLTP和OLAP系统的分离架构已无法满足现代应用场景的需求。HTAP系统通过融合事务处理和分析处理能力,成为数据库领域的重要发展方向。存储引擎作为HTAP系统的核心组件,其存储格式的选择直接影响系统性能。行式存储适合事务处理场景,而列式存储则更适合分析处理场景。本报告提出了一种基于工作负载感知的动态存储格式切换机制,能够根据查询特征自动选择最优存储格式,从而在事务处理和分析处理之间取得平衡。报告详细分析了该机制的理论基础、技术路线、实施方案和预期效果,并对其潜在风险进行了评估。研究表明,该机制能够显著提升HTAP系统的综合性能,在保持事务处理能力的同时,将分析查询性能提升25倍,为企业的数字化转型提供有力支撑。

关键词

引言与背景

1.1研究背景

随着数字化转型的深入推进,企业面临的数据环境日益复杂。根据国际数据公司(IDC)的预测,全球数据总量预计将从2020年的64.2ZB增长到2025年的175ZB,年复合增长率达26%。在这一背景下,企业对数据处理能力提出了更高要求,既需要支持高并发的事务处理(OLTP),又需要满足复杂分析查询(OLAP)的需求。传统的解决方案通常采用OLTP和OLAP系统分离的架构,通过ETL过程将事务数据同步到分析系统。然而,这种架构存在数据延迟、架构复杂、维护成本高等问题。

HTAP(HybridTransactional/AnalyticalProcessing)系统应运而生,它能够在同一系统中同时支持事务处理和分析处理,消除了数据孤岛,实现了实时分析。Gartner预测,到2025年,将有75%的数据库采用HTAP架构。存储引擎作为HTAP系统的核心组件,其设计直接影响系统性能。行式存储(RoworientedStorage)和列式存储(ColumnorientedStorage)各有优劣:行式存储适合点查询和写入密集型操作,而列式存储则在大范围扫描和聚合计算方面表现优异。如何根据工作负载特征动态选择最优存储格式,成为HTAP系统设计的关键挑战。

1.2研究意义

本研究的意义主要体现在三个方面:首先,从技术角度看,动态存储格式切换机制能够突破传统存储引擎的局限性,实现存储格式的自适应优化,提升HTAP系统的综合性能。其次,从应用角度看,该机制可以帮助企业简化数据架构,降低运维成本,同时满足事务和分析需求,加速业务决策。最后,从产业角度看,随着HTAP市场的快速增长(据MarketsandMarkets预测,全球HTAP市场规模将从2021年的12亿美元增长到2026年的45亿美元),本研究有助于推动我国数据库产业的发展,提升国际竞争力。

1.3研究内容与结构

本报告围绕HTAP系统中列式存储与行式存储的动态切换机制展开研究,主要内容包括:分析HTAP系统的发展现状和挑战;探讨行式存储和列式存储的技术特点;设计基于工作负载感知的动态切换机制;提出系统实施方案和评估方法;分析潜在风险及应对措施。报告结构如下:第一章介绍研究背景和意义;第二章分析政策与行业环境;第三章诊断现状与问题;第四章阐述理论基础;第五章设定研究目标;第六章提出技术路线;第七章设计实施方案;第八章进行效益分析;第九章评估风险;第十章提出保障措施;最后总结研究结论并展望未来方向。

政策与行业环境分析

2.1国家政策支持

近年来,我国高度重视数据库产业发展,出台了一系列支持政策。《十四五数字经济发展规划》明确提出要突破数据库等关键软件技术,《软件和信息技术服务业发展规划)》也将数据库列为重点发展领域。2021年,工信部发布的《十四五软件和信息技术服务业发展规划》进一步强调要提升数据库等基础软件的自主可控能力。这些政策为HTAP系统研发提供了良好的政策环境。

在数据安全方面,《数据安全法》和《个人信息保护法》的实施,要求企业加强数据管理能力,HTAP系统通过统一架构减少数据流转,有助于降低安全风险。同时,《关键信息基础设施安全保护条例》强调关键领域技术的自主可控,为国产HTAP系统发展创造了机遇。

2.2行业发展趋势

全球HTAP市场呈现快速增长态势。根据Gartner的报告,2022年全球数据库管理系统市场规模达800亿美元,其中HTAP系统占比约15%,预计到2025年将增长至30%。行业领先企业如SAPHANA、Oracle、Microsoft等均已推出HTAP产品。国内厂商如阿里云、腾讯云、华为等也在积极布局,推出了PolarDB、TDSQL、Gaus

文档评论(0)

139****2524 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档